Oklahoma Code § 47-1116.2

Title 47. Motor Vehicles: Operation of golf carts by persons with physical

disability.
A.  Notwithstanding any other provision of law, any person with
a physical disability as defined by Section 15-112 of Title 47 of
the Oklahoma Statutes shall be authorized to operate golf carts to
the extent that the physically disabled person is capable as
determined by a physician as defined by Section 15-112 of Title 47
of the Oklahoma Statutes if:
1.  Such operation is within the boundaries of a park owned by
this state;
2.  Operation occurs during daylight hours only;
3.  The golf cart does not exceed the speed limit in such area
as determined by the Oklahoma Tourism and Recreation Department;
4.  The golf cart is not operated on roadways within park
boundaries with posted speed limits greater than twenty-five (25)
miles per hour;
5.  The operator of such golf cart possesses a valid driver
license; and
6.  The operator of such golf cart shall provide certified proof
of his or her disability.
B.  The Tourism and Recreation Commission shall designate areas
of operation for golf carts in each state park as appropriate, and
establish rules for the safe operation of golf carts pursuant to
this act.

Added by Laws 2002, c. 318, § 1, eff. Nov. 1, 2002.  Renumbered from
Title 47, § 1151.2 by Laws 2008, c. 302, § 14, emerg. eff. June 2,
2008.
